WRAS Approval vs. Regulation 4 (Reg4) Certification for Water Tanks: What’s Legally Required - and What Proves It
Home » Water Regulation » WRAS vs Reg4 Certification for Water Tanks: Legal Requirements & Compliance Guide
Ensuring potable water safety in the UK hinges on compliance with the Water Supply (Water Fittings) Regulations 1999. For water tanks and their components, Regulation 4 is the legal benchmark; WRAS Approval and Reg4 certifications (e.g., NSF REG4, Kiwa KUKreg4) are voluntary routes used to demonstrate that a product meets those legal requirements. In practice, UK water authorities accept either route as valid evidence, provided the product has been tested against the same underlying standards (e.g., BS 6920 and relevant regulator specifications)
1) The Legal Foundation: What Regulation 4 Requires
Regulation 4 states that every water fitting “shall be of an appropriate quality and standard” and “suitable for the circumstances in which it is used.” This requirement covers tanks as finished assemblies and the materials/components used within them (e.g., coatings, seals, valves). Installing noncompliant fittings can trigger enforcement by water undertakers and constitutes a criminal offence.
To evidence compliance, dutyholders (manufacturers, installers, specifiers) may rely on multiple forms of documentation—including independent test reports and certifications from recognized schemes such as WRAS, NSF REG4, or Kiwa KUKreg4. Water undertakers can consider such documentation when assessing Regulation 4(1)(a) (quality and standard) compliance.
2) WRAS Approval: The Historic Pathway (Voluntary, Not Mandatory)
The Water Regulations Approval Scheme (WRAS) has long been the most familiar mark in UK plumbing specifications. It is a voluntary product approval that confirms compliance with Regulation 4 through thirdparty testing and a review by the Product Approvals Advisory Group (PAAG), which typically meets on a 4–6week cycle. This cadence can extend total approval time.
WRAS’s popularity stems from history and market familiarity, not legal necessity. Today, WRAS decisions are made independently of water companies; its role is one of recognized, independent evidence of Reg4 compliance—useful and widely specified, but not the only acceptable proof.
Validity: WRAS approvals are typically issued for five years, after which products require reassessment—an interval aligned with other leading schemes.
3) Reg4 Certification via NSF or Kiwa KUKreg4: Direct to the Legal Requirement
NSF REG4 and Kiwa KUKreg4 are certification schemes that test products directly against the requirements underpinning Regulation 4—most notably BS 6920 for materials in contact with drinking water, plus applicable mechanical and hygiene criteria. Because much of the testing occurs inhouse (e.g., NSF laboratories in the UK), lead times are often shorter than the traditional WRAS route.
Both NSF and Kiwa position their Reg4 schemes as equally robust and widely accepted by UK water authorities. Industry guidance and commentary confirm that KUKreg4 provides the same level of compliance evidence as WRAS, since the test bases and acceptance principles align to Regulation 4.
Validity: Like WRAS, Reg4 certificates commonly run on a fiveyear cycle
4) What This Means for Water Tanks
Whether you choose WRAS or NSF/Kiwa Reg4, tanks must show that:
1. Materials are safe for contact with drinking water (BS 6920):
Nonmetallic components (liners, gaskets, elastomers, coatings) must not affect taste or odour, promote microbial growth, or leach harmful substances. This is a foundational requirement for both WRAS and Reg4 schemes.
2.The assembly prevents contamination and backflow:
Certification examines design elements and specified devices to ensure tanks do not compromise the supply.
3.Components are fit for purpose and suitable for the installation conditions:
Mechanical integrity, pressure/temperature suitability, and hygiene controls are assessed under both routes.
Bottom line: For tanks, WRAS Approval and NSF/Kiwa Reg4 certification are accepted as equivalent evidence that the product complies with the legal requirement—Regulation 4.
5) How to Choose: Practical Considerations
Choose WRAS
if your project explicitly requires the WRAS name or if stakeholder familiarity makes this the smoother path to specification acceptance.
Choose NSF/Kiwa Reg4
if you need a faster or more streamlined route. Inhouse testing and singlebody certification can reduce time by roughly 4–6 weeks, depending on product scope and lab capacity.
In either case, ensure your tank’s bill of materials (elastomers, coatings, fittings) and assembled unit are covered within the certification scope, and keep certificates current within their fiveyear validity window.
6) Common Misconceptions (and the Facts)
Misconception 1: “WRAS is legally required.”
Fact: The legal requirement is Regulation 4; WRAS is a voluntary approval used to demonstrate compliance. Equivalent Reg4 certifications (NSF/Kiwa) are also accepted by water authorities.
Misconception 2: “Only WRAS is accepted by water companies.”
Fact: Water undertakers assess Regulation 4 compliance and accept credible evidence (including NSF REG4 and Kiwa KUKreg4 certificates) that a product meets the standard.
Misconception 3: “WRAS and Reg4 test to different standards.”
Fact: Both pathways rely on BS 6920 for materials and applicable performance criteria set out for Reg4—so the underlying technical tests are aligned, even if the administrative processes differ.
Misconception 4: “WRAS is always faster.”
Fact: WRAS includes PAAG review cycles, which can lengthen timelines; NSF/Kiwa often deliver faster turnarounds through inhouse testing and certification.
Misconception 5: “Zip Water/industry talking points are out of date—WRAS is still the only game in town.”
Fact: Industry guidance now routinely references multiple accepted certification bodies (WRAS, NSF, Kiwa) for demonstrating Reg4 compliance, reflecting the current acceptance landscape.

8) Practical Takeaways for Specifiers and Installers
- Specify Regulation 4 compliance as the nonnegotiable legal baseline; then name WRAS or NSF/Kiwa Reg4 as acceptable evidence.
- For timecritical projects, consider NSF REG4 or Kiwa KUKreg4 to shorten approval timelines without compromising rigour.
- Verify scope and components: ensure the certificate covers the full tank assembly (materials, coatings, seals, valves) and keep documentation accessible for water undertakers.
